1. Types of Damage to Composite Doors

Composite doors, while strong, can suffer from numerous types of damage. Understanding these can assist property owners address problems more efficiently.

Kind of DamageDescription
Cosmetic DamageDamages, scratches, or staining on the surface area.
Structural DamageProblems impacting the door's frame or core that affect its stability.
Mechanical FailuresProblems with locks, hinges, or other moving parts that hinder functionality.

1.1 Cosmetic Damage

Cosmetic damage includes surface-level issues such as scratches, damages, or fading. While these do not generally impact the door's function, they can diminish your home's curb appeal.

1.2 Structural Damage

Structural damage normally happens to the frame or the core material of the door. This kind of damage can considerably affect the security and insulation residential or commercial properties of the door.

1.3 Mechanical Failures

Mechanical failures involve the parts that allow the door to run, such as locks, hinges, and handles. If any of these parts breakdown, they can prevent the door from closing appropriately and even make it lockable.


2. Typical Causes of Damage

Numerous aspects can contribute to the wear and tear of composite doors. Comprehending these causes can assist property owners in preventing future issues.

TriggerDescription
Weather condition ConditionsSevere temperatures, rain, snow, and humidity can damage door surface areas.
Poor InstallationIncorrectly fitted doors can cause gaps and misalignment in time.
Lack of MaintenanceOverlooking regular cleansing and maintenance can lead to deterioration.

2.1 Weather Conditions

Composite doors are created to hold up against different weather condition conditions, but extreme temperature variations and extended direct exposure to wetness can still cause damage over time. Rain and snow can cause rot or swelling if water leaks into the door's core.

2.2 Poor Installation

An improperly installed door can lead to alignment problems, which may trigger stress on hinges and locks. Spaces where the door does not fit comfortably can result in drafts, jeopardizing energy effectiveness.

2.3 Lack of Maintenance

Routine maintenance is essential for lengthening the life of a composite door. Overlooking to clean, examine, or repair small issues can result in bigger problems down the line.

4. Maintenance Tips for Composite Doors

Proper maintenance can avoid lots of problems related to composite doors. Here are some essential ideas:

  1. Regular Cleaning: Wipe down the surface with a mild detergent and water frequently to avoid dirt buildup.
  2. Inspect Seals: Check the seals around the door for any signs of wear and replace them if needed to avoid drafts.
  3. Lube Mechanical Parts: Keep locks and hinges operating smoothly with routine lubrication.
  4. Confirm Weather Stripping: Ensure weather condition stripping is undamaged to keep insulation and security.
  5. Yearly Professional Inspection: Consider scheduling a yearly check-up with a professional to catch any potential issues early.
